Ramadan is the ninth month of the Islamic calendar. It is considered a holy month that honours the time when Allah, via the angel Gabriel, revealed the first verses of the Qur’an, the holy book of Islam, to a caravan trader named Muhammad.

3 events,Eid al-Fitr, or the Festival of Sweets, is the earlier of the two official holidays celebrated within Islam. The religious holiday is celebrated by Muslims worldwide because it marks the end of the month-long dawn-to-sunset fasting of Ramadan. |
3 events,Observed annually on March 21st, the International Day of the Elimination of Racial Discrimination marks the day in the 1966 when the UN General Assembly called on the international community to redouble its efforts to eliminate all forms of racial discrimination. |

3 events,Good Friday is the Christian holiday commemorating the crucifixion of Jesus and his death at Calvary. It is observed as part of Paschal Triduum, the three days that observes the passion, crucifixion, death, burial and resurrection of Jesus. Good Friday is also known as Holy Friday, Great Friday, Great and Holy Friday and Black Friday. |
3 events,Easter, also called Pascha or Resurrection Sunday, is a Christian festival and cultural holiday commemorating the resurrection of Jesus from the dead, described in the New Testament as having occurred on the third day of his burial following his crucifixion by the Romans at Calvary c. 30 AD. |
